POSITIONING THE RIGHT TO HOUSING IN INTERNATIONAL HUMAN RIGHTS

LAW: AN OUTLINE FOR THE PROTECTION OF MIGRANTS AND ASYLUM-


SEEKERS

ABSTRACT-

The human right to shelter is of fundamental importance for the enjoyment of all other rights.
The right to housing is evidently linked to the integral dignity of the human being and is
crucial for the realization of other human rights enshrined in the International Bill of Human
Rights. It is also indivisible from social justice, necessitating the adoption of proper
economic, environmental and social policies, at both the national and international levels,
concerned with eradication of poverty and the accomplishment of all human rights for all.

JUSTIFICATION-

International human rights law recognizes everyone’s right to an adequate standard of living,
including adequate housing. Regardless of this right within the global legal system, well over
a billion people are not properly housed. Heaps around the globe live in life- or health
threatening conditions, in congested slums and informal settlements, or in other conditions
which do not uphold their human rights and their dignity. Further increasing insecurities
among the native people of that particular country led to violence with the refugees and
migrants they are forcibly evicted, or threatened with forced eviction, from their homes every
year
